Output 74943236dfb77ff77a2da6041f60f2ad3fbd222651eb6e0672fc9ce4d18733c9:1

value
6463593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c07ddbf0d527eab766ede37370e3f4e5791cd007 OP_EQUAL
address
3KEpSDpNrXiryAeXqrGBMuEfudahnuBfp4
transaction
74943236dfb77ff77a2da6041f60f2ad3fbd222651eb6e0672fc9ce4d18733c9
confirmations
273567
spent
true